The Magic Number: 25
Season 5 clocks in at 25 episodes. That's... fine. It's the standard length for most My Hero Academia seasons. But is it enough? Hmm...
For some, 25 episodes are plenty. For others (like maybe me), it felt a little... rushed in places. Anyone else feel that way?

The Joint Training Arc: A Divisive Point
The Joint Training Arc was… interesting. We got to see Class 1-A and Class 1-B duke it out. Some loved it. Others, not so much.
Personally? I think it could have benefited from a few more episodes. Really let those battles breathe. Show off those Quirks!
Maybe three or four extra episodes? Explore each match a bit more fully? Just a thought!

The Meta Liberation Army Arc: Content Overload?
Then we have the Meta Liberation Army Arc. Okay, this one was packed! So much happened, so quickly. It’s like they were speedrunning a marathon!
The League of Villains got some serious development. Shigaraki leveled up big time. But did we really get to feel that transformation?
Maybe one or two extra episodes here could have fleshed things out. Give us more of Shigaraki's backstory. Let the tension build.
